Hi, Could someone give me information about this baldwin serial # 436689- 45" height- model 243hpw- I am thinking of purchasing it from a private seller- Is it American Made? What does the HPW stand for? I'd love to jump on this as it seems like a good deal- but I want to verify the age etc and have my tuner check it out. Thanks so much!!!!

The number doesn't quite match up with my atlas..

That SN only matches with the 48" baldwins the 248A pro. It doesn't say anything about the 234hpw, sorry the Baldwins SN's can be confusing to look up.

Since the SN only matches that of piano built in the early 90's it would be a pretty safe bet this one was made in that time period as well.

I do not know where it was made.

In the Piano Atlas, one looks under Hamilton to check Baldwin 243 serial numbers. Your number indicates that the piano was built in 1991 and it was made in America. It is probably a satin walnut finish. Be sure to have your tech check it out. The 243 is generally a really nice instrument if it has been cared for.
